WebThe Layer to bottom command lowers the active layer to the bottom of the layer stack. If the active layer is already at the bottom of the stack or if there is only one layer, this menu entry is insensitive and grayed out. 7.20.1. Activating the Command. WebNov 27, 2014 · Followed by the answer from jjlin: PNG is lossless. GIMP is most likely not using the best choice of wording in this case. Think of it as quality of compression or level of compression. With lower compression, you get a bigger file, but it takes less time to produce, whereas with higher compression, you get a smaller file that takes longer to ... corwin ford of nampa
